    The Fosters To End After Season 5 As Freeform Orders Spinoff

    It has been announced that The Fosters will be coming to an end after season five. The news comes as bittersweet to the cast and fans of the show, but fortunately this isn’t the end for two characters.

    The Fosters will be finishing one chapter and opening a new one with the help of Callie Adams-Foster (Maia Mitchell) and Mariana Adams-Foster (Cierra Ramirez).

    The Disney owned cable network is set to conclude the drama’s five season run with a three-night limited series event in the summer. The three-night event will also introduce the straight-to-series 13-episode order spinoff, featuring Maia Mitchell and Cierra Ramirez, as they embark on their new adventures to adulthood.

    “First and foremost, we want to thank our fans, our supportive ‘Fosters Family’, and Freeform for fostering this show,” Joanna Johnson, Bradley Bredeweg and Peter Paige said Wednesday, announcing the news in a joint statement. “It’s been the privilege of our lives to get to shepherd this beautiful family through five seasons of love, laughter, heartbreak, tribulation and triumph — and message to the world that DNA doesn’t make a family, love does. All while allowing us to explore some of the most pressing social issues of our era. Now that the kids are growing up, it’s time to take them out into the world, to see them make their way into adulthood, continuing their search for identity and love, and the pursuit of their dreams and purpose in this ever changing world.”

    The spinoff will be designed to follow the lives of Callie and Mariana, as they move on from their high school lives to the glamorous life of Los Angeles. The new show will be a time jump and is expected to deliver the same amount of high quality in controversial subjects as The Fosters did, due to the original producing team still being behind this new show.

    While we have to say our happiest goodbyes to the likes of; Stef, Lena, Brandon, Jesus, Jude, Mike, Ana and Gabe… We have luckily been promised to have guest appearances from hopefully the majority of our most beloved characters, as it just won’t be the same without them.

    5B will consist of 10 episodes and returns January 9th on Freeform, which will also include their 100th episode landmark. The producing team will be exactly the same, alongside executive producer, Jennifer Lopez. Additional casting for the spinoff is expected to be revealed later on in the year.
